The Chance Vought F4U Corsair was arguably the finest naval aviation fighter of its era. Work on this design dates to 1938 and was headed up by Voughts Chief Engineer, Rex Biesel. The initial prototype was powered by an 1800 HP Pratt & Whitney double Wasp radial engine. This was the third Vought aircraft to carry the Corsair name.
